Building a Solid Website: Timeframe for Design and Development in the Crypto Space

When launching a crypto-related online business, a well-designed and functional website is crucial for attracting users and building trust. The design and development phase can take anywhere from a few weeks to several months, depending on various factors such as the complexity of features, platform requirements, and desired user experience. This timeframe is essential to consider, especially in the crypto industry, where security and user interface design play significant roles in credibility.

The development process typically includes several stages such as planning, wireframing, development, testing, and deployment. Each of these steps requires careful attention to detail, especially when dealing with sensitive financial transactions and user data, as is common in the cryptocurrency sector.

Key Phases in Crypto Website Development

  • Planning & Strategy: Understanding business goals and audience needs for appropriate website features (1-2 weeks).
  • Design & Wireframing: Drafting a visual concept and user flow (2-3 weeks).
  • Development: Coding the site, integrating necessary blockchain APIs, and ensuring security protocols (3-8 weeks).
  • Testing & Optimization: Thorough testing to ensure functionality, speed, and security (2-4 weeks).
  • Launch: Final deployment and monitoring for potential issues (1 week).

Factors Affecting Development Time

"In crypto, the website's security must be a priority, and this requires additional time for audits and verification before going live."

  1. Security Requirements: The need for strong encryption, wallet integration, and anti-fraud measures may extend development time.
  2. API Integration: Blockchain API integration or third-party service connections can slow down development, depending on their complexity.
  3. Design Complexity: A more intricate, user-friendly design or additional features like real-time price updates or a trading platform can add weeks to the process.
  4. Responsive Design: Ensuring compatibility with mobile devices requires additional coding and testing time.

Development Timeline Overview

Phase Estimated Time
Planning & Strategy 1-2 weeks
Design & Wireframing 2-3 weeks
Development 3-8 weeks
Testing & Optimization 2-4 weeks
Launch 1 week

Creating a Product or Service in the Cryptocurrency Sector: Key Steps and Time Expectations

Launching a product or service in the cryptocurrency industry requires careful planning and execution due to its dynamic and highly technical nature. While the initial development stages can be similar to any tech startup, the unique regulatory and security challenges present specific hurdles that need to be addressed early on. The timeline for creating a crypto-related offering largely depends on the complexity of the product, market demand, and available resources.

Understanding the market and ensuring compliance with the laws of various jurisdictions are essential first steps. However, building a viable product or service also involves designing robust security features, establishing a trusted blockchain infrastructure, and creating user-friendly interfaces for a seamless experience. The timeframe for these stages can vary based on the type of product being developed.

Steps to Create a Crypto Product/Service

  • Market Research: Understanding the target audience, competitors, and market trends. This phase often takes 2-4 weeks.
  • Defining Product Scope: Outlining features, functionalities, and use cases. This can take 3-6 weeks, depending on product complexity.
  • Blockchain & Security Infrastructure: Choosing the right blockchain network and integrating necessary security measures, including smart contracts. Expect 8-12 weeks.
  • Development & Testing: Writing code, developing the interface, and conducting rigorous testing to ensure stability and security. This is typically a 3-6 month process.
  • Launch & Marketing: Preparing the launch campaign, including a detailed marketing strategy. This step takes about 4-8 weeks.

Expected Timeframe Breakdown

Step Estimated Time
Market Research 2-4 weeks
Defining Product Scope 3-6 weeks
Blockchain Development & Security Setup 8-12 weeks
Development & Testing 3-6 months
Launch & Marketing 4-8 weeks

Important: Every phase is crucial for the overall success of your crypto product. Rushing through any stage could compromise its security and viability in the market.

Building an Email List for a Cryptocurrency Business: Key Milestones and Time Commitment

When it comes to growing an online cryptocurrency business, building an email list is crucial for long-term success. Email marketing allows you to directly engage with potential customers, share valuable content, and offer services or updates on cryptocurrency projects. The process of establishing a strong email list, however, requires careful planning, strategic milestones, and consistent time investment.

The time required to grow an email list can vary depending on your strategies, content quality, and audience engagement. Generally, it can take anywhere from several months to a year to develop a substantial list, especially in the cryptocurrency niche where trust and credibility are vital. Below are the key milestones involved in this process and the expected time commitment.

Key Milestones in Building an Email List for Cryptocurrency

  • Initial Setup (1-3 months): This phase involves choosing an email marketing platform, setting up your sign-up forms, and developing an initial lead magnet (e.g., free eBook or crypto tips). You should focus on targeting niche crypto enthusiasts who are interested in your project or content.
  • Content Creation & Engagement (3-6 months): Regularly providing valuable content such as newsletters, market insights, or exclusive crypto news can help grow your subscriber base. Engagement at this stage is key–responding to subscribers' questions and offering exclusive deals or updates can boost retention.
  • Optimization & Scaling (6-12 months): After the initial growth, analyze your email campaigns' performance. A/B testing subject lines, improving your content strategy, and expanding your reach will help you scale your list faster. Integration with other crypto platforms or influencers can also amplify growth.

Time Commitment Breakdown

Phase Time Investment (per week) Focus
Initial Setup 5-10 hours Choosing platform, creating lead magnet, setting up forms
Content Creation & Engagement 10-15 hours Writing newsletters, responding to emails, creating offers
Optimization & Scaling 15-20 hours Analyzing data, A/B testing, expanding reach

Important Tip: Be consistent with your email campaigns. Regular communication with your subscribers, especially in a fast-moving space like cryptocurrency, helps maintain their interest and trust in your brand.
